Tornado activity:

Wykoff-area historical tornado activity is significantly above Minnesota state average. It is 112%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/15/1968, a category F5 (max. wind speeds 261-318 mph) tornado 16.7 miles away from the Wykoff city center killed 13 people and injured 462 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.

On 5/10/1953, a category F4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 19.0 miles away from the city center killed 2 people and injured 24 people.

Natural disasters:

The number of natural disasters in Fillmore County (12) is near the US average (12).
Major Disasters (Presidential) Declared: 10
Emergencies Declared: 2

Causes of natural disasters: Storms: 7, Floods: 6, Tornadoes: 4, Floods: 2, Wind: 1, Drought: 1, Hurricane: 1, Ice Storm: 1 (Note: Some incidents may be assigned to more than one category).
